Tour operator easyJet holidays has once again been recognised for delivering outstanding customer experience, earning the prestigious Good Housekeeping Institute Reader recommended endorsement for the second year running.

The accolade is based on direct feedback from Good Housekeeping readers, who rated their experience across every stage of the journey when booking and travelling on an easyJet holidays package.

Their responses highlighted the package holiday provider’s consistent commitment to quality, value, and ease, with particular praise for:

Excellent value for money
Unbeatable prices across a wide range of breaks
ATOL-protected packages for peace of mind
A diverse choice of destinations across Europe’s most-loved hotspots
The recognition comes follows easyJet holidays recently receiving the Feefo Platinum Trusted Service Award 2026, reflecting the holiday provider’s unwavering commitment to its customers and their holiday experiences.
